Show KAHN UROH. Wholesale Grocers, 131 and 133 South East Temple Street. There is no more important branch of commerce in any largo city than the wholesale grocery trade, becauso this department of industry includes every article of food. One of the largest and most active and enterprising grocery firms in the entire west is that of Kahu Bros., established in 18W. strict attention to business busi-ness coupled with a straight forward system of honorable dealing they have built up a trade that amounts to over $1,000,000 annually, and is gradually grad-ually increasing as the years roll around. The premises occupied are two stories and basement, i)0xl5O feet in dimensions, di-mensions, which are filled with an immense im-mense stock of staple and fancy groceries, gro-ceries, teas, cigars, syrups, smoked moats, etc. In short, everything usually found in an extonsive and ably managed man-aged grocery house. Their trade extends ex-tends all over the entire west. Twelve men are required to trausact the enormous enor-mous busiuess of the house. Altogether the showing of their house is exceedingly exceed-ingly creditable to the city of Salt Lake as indicating the stability aud growth of her various enterprises. The lirm occupy a commanding position iu the commercial world, and aro noted for their sound principles and honorable methods of doing business. They are the agents for tho well kuown manufacturers manu-facturers of Key West cigars, and exclusive ex-clusive agents for the famous La Gloria cigar factory of Cincinnati. The proprietor pro-prietor Is Mr. E. Kahn, who is justly regarded a self mad a man in every respect. re-spect. No one stands higher or is moro deserving of the success he has met iu business. |
